Duties and Responsibilities:

Reporting to a Supervisor, Facilities or designate, this position will be responsible for:
  • Performing all necessary cleaning duties in the facilities such as sweeping, mopping, dusting, cleaning washroom facilities, furniture, windows, walls, ceilings, floors, carpet cleaning, vacuuming, cleaning sinks and toilets, air vents, appliances, collect garbage, and replenish paper and chemical supplies. 
  • Writing reports for stock, report maintenance and building repair issues.  Will perform minor repairs as required. 
  • Minor repairs such as replacement of lights, perform outside duties related to entrances such as snow removal and cleaning, and perform security duties.
  • Assisting with furniture moving, set up rooms for special events, strip, wax and polish floors.
  • May be required to use a forklift to assist in deliveries and/or garbage bins.
  • May be required to use a golf cart to bring garbage to dumpster.
  • Performing all general tasks associated with the operation of caretaking division, including basic maintenance of all equipment used and keeping it clean.
  • Attending all mandatory in-service training and maintain professional relations with the public and fellow staff. 
  • Performing Occupational Health & Safety duties as outlined in the Corporation’s Health and Safety Program. 
  • Perform other related duties as required.

Qualifications:

  • Must have an Ontario Secondary School Graduation Diploma or Ontario Ministry of Education equivalency;
  • Must have up to three (3) months of experience with current cleaning practices, WHMIS, operation and maintenance of cleaning equipment;
  • Must hold and maintain a current valid and lawful Class ‘G’ Driver’s License in accordance with the Highway Traffic Act, for the purposes of operating a City of Windsor vehicle and provide a driver’s abstract as a condition of employment;
  • Must be able to complete assigned duties with a minimum of supervision;
  • Must maintain good relations with corporate staff and general public;
  • Must be willing and able to work any shift;
  • General knowledge of operation and maintenance of cleaning equipment is a definite asset;
  • Proven commitment to ongoing professional development is considered an asset;
  • Must complete a post-offer agility test in an effort to assist the successful candidate in completing the position tasks safely and to aid in minimizing injuries on the job.

Physical Demands:

  • The physical demands analysis associated with this job indicates a light to heavy level of work.
